    Tie rod ends. L & R, or not?

    Here is a puzzle. Falcon Parts uses one tie rod end for both the left and right side. Mac's auto parts sells two different tie rod ends, one for the left and one for the right. Which do you think is correct?

    Falcon Parts:
    Tie rods outer (2) 1963-1964 V-8 MANUAL STEERING OUTER TIE ROD ENDS SKU: C3DZ-3A130-G This part serves as the left hand or right hand outer tie rod end for all models of the 1963 & 1964 Ford Falcon & Mercury Comet equipped with a V-8 engine & manual steering. It is also used as the right hand outer tie rod end on all models of the 1963 & 1964 Ford Falcon & Mercury Comet equipped with a V-8 engine & power steering. The adjusting threads on this tie rod end are RIGHT Hand. Falcon Parts $87.95 x 2 = $175.90.

    I know in 1965 the two inner are the same and the two outer are the same - if you have manual steering, but I'm not so sure earlier models. I installed '65 manual parts on my '63. The '64 parts are one-off and may carry back into '63 cars too. They did weird stuff those years. If they look identical (thread size and rotation, length, bends) then they likely are the same. Power steering car, not so.

    Thanks for the input. I believe that Falcon Parts is correct and that the left and right outer tie rod ends are the same based on the following picture. I bought a CD called "1960-1968 Ford Car, Part Diagrams and Exploded Views" and found a page labeled "1963/64 Manual Steering Linkage (Falcon 8 Cylinder)". The diagram labels the outer tie rod ends as "3289" and the inner tie rod ends as "3290". That indicates to me that there is no left or right, just two each of inner and outer.

    Here is the idler arm. The long rod in the background is the center link. Wikipedia says: "The idler arm supports the end of the center link on the passengers side of the vehicle. The idler arm bolts to the vehicle's frame or subframe. Generally, an idler arm is attached between the opposite side of the center link from the Pitman arm and the vehicle's frame to hold the center link at the proper height. Idler arms are generally more vulnerable to wear than Pitman arms because of the pivot function built into them. If the idler arm is fitted with grease fittings, these should be lubricated with a grease gun at each oil change."
    2 Idler arm right side to center link.jpg

    Pitman arm to center link. The tie rod adjusting sleeve is in the center background. "The Pitman arm is a linkage attached to the steering box (see recirculating ball) sector shaft, that converts the angular motion of the sector shaft into the linear motion needed to steer the wheels." ** "1963 ½ Falcon V-8 vehicles used 1 1/8 inch sectors shafts, six cylinder cars used a one-inch shaft."

    If your coil spring perches are the original bronze bushing type I'd re use those or go with the opentracker roller perches.

    The replacement bushing type in my personal opinion don't rotate as well as the bronze bushing type do and puts the suspension in a bind. Plus they have a tendency to squeak.

    opentracker is expensive at $119 a pair.. and a little overkill for a street car, but are a good alternative.

    Finding NOS bronze bushing type perches is difficult at best. So unless yours are real sloppy lots of play in the cross shaft the rides on the bushings I say clean them up and reuse them.

    You are correct that the original pieces rotated on a metal shaft and bushings shaft (see diagram below). That indicates that the piece was intended to rotate freely. Whether my car still has the original piece or not has yet to be discovered.

    But .... I read that the rubber-bushings have advantages over the metal bushings or roller bearings in that the rubber bushings insulate the car from road noise, they cannot be damaged by a sudden shock as can bearings, and they do not require lubrication as do the bearings.

    The roller bearings do rotate more freely, and I am trying to understand how that lessens "bind" in the suspension and what effect that would have on handling. The bottom of the shock absorber bolts (I think) to the spring perch and if the perch does not rotate freely its angle will change as the control arm moves up and down. This would put a small amount of twist on both the coil spring and the shock absorber. I guess that the twist would work against keeping the tires square on the road and would make the car feel less stable.
